I set out early in the morning to give myself plenty of time to hunt while in the forest with Jareth, it still took nearly an hour to get to the center of the city. Before I enter the gate, I go to a quick breakfast stand and purchase a 1 credit meal of sausage and eggs with a biscuit. Before I chow down I bring out Jareth to give him a goblin core for his morning meal. After finishing our respective meals we set out through the gate and into the forest and begin looking for monsters to fight.
It's funny how monsters that used to haunt my nightmares are beginning to look more and more like moving bags of money that have yet to be cashed in. The first thing we come across is a horned rabbit that Jareth quickly disposes of when it jumps to impale him on its horn, but Jareth simply moves to the side and proceeds to bash in its head with 2 hits of his club. He really seems to have a thing about crushing monsters' heads, must be his version popping bubble wrap albeit much gorier. I guess it's better than having him wound up and getting violent at some inopportune time, plus it's way cheaper than therapy.
We continue wandering around and after 2 hours and having slayed 8 more monsters we finally decide to come to a rest. I bring out another meal I had previously purchased, this time it was a roasted meat sandwich with lettuce and tomato, but before I dig in I make sure to give Jareth his meal after working so hard.
He smiles gleefully at the sight of the goblin core I hand him and quickly goes to sit next to me with his back to the tree I decided to rest against and seems to mimic my eating by nibbling at the core with his sharp teeth. I laugh at the similarities between Jareth eating and a squirrel nibbling at some acorns, and when Jareth looks questioningly at me I just wave him off figuring it's better he doesn't know I was comparing him to a rodent.

After the break, we continue moving and head a bit deeper into the forest where tier 2 monsters will begin to appear. Not long after entering the noticeably denser forest we come across a tier 2 iron-hide boar, it had bristly gray fur covering its entire body and its' tusks were jutting out sharply as if they were miniature scythes sprouting from its mouth.
Jareth launched himself into battle without me even needing to prompt him, but due to their similar strengths, it became a battle of attrition with each monster continued circling each other looking for any opening to exploit. The boar seemed to fight by relying on its sharp tusks to eviscerate anything that it charges towards. It seems to lack intelligence as this was pretty much all it did.
After countless charges that were avoided or redirected by trees and one close call that left a deep gash on Jareth's left side, the boar made a mistake that left an opening for Jareth to exploit who had been waiting patiently at my behest. With impressive reflexes Jareth brings his club down from overhead in a side sweeping motion and bashes the boars' left hind leg, breaking it. Jareth then quickly moves away from the boars sharp tusks which its sweeps towards Jareth in an attempt to gouge him while he is still within range of it in retaliation for injuring the boar quite badly.
The boar is left exposed and immobile, and Jareth approaches the boar from the side with determined movements and fakes it out at the last second by pretending to swing towards its' head which resulted in the boar committing to try and fend Jareth off from its front, this quickly results in the other hind leg being taken out leaving the boar effectively immobile. With half of its' limbs not working the boar can no longer move to defend itself and Jareth quickly ends its life with a few quick bashes to the back of the boars' neck which eventually breaks its' spine killing it soon after.
Seeing Jareth with a few deep scratches from his battle of attrition with the boar, I dress him in some bandages I had tucked away in my storage space to keep his wounds from getting any worse and feed him the core from the boar as a reward for his hard-fought battle. He seemed to not care about his wound which continued to drip blood and was instead engrossed in eating the core which he seemed to especially savor as if his personal conquest of the boar made it taste all the sweeter. I decided to end our hunt here rather than risk additional injuries to Jareth because if he goes down then I have nothing left to protect me from any monsters I might run into, not even a knife and I'm beginning to understand just how much of a mistake that is.

With the corpse packed away along with the other 9 bodies after retrieving the rest of their cores, I begin to head back towards the gate to get back to civilization. I still find it strange how one step takes me into a completely different realm, going from a grassy meadow to the cobblestone streets of the North American Continental City that I now call home.
The first thing I do after passing through the gate is to go submit the cores I had earned today at the core exchange, which earned me 9 credits in total since I let Jareth eat the iron-hide boar core. With that taken care of I decide to receive the rest of my money by selling the corpses to the Summoner Association. Each of the tier 1 monsters we killed today sold for 3 credits per, and the boar corpse sold for 25 credits due to the value of its' hide and the tusks that can be made into daggers. It would have been 28 credits but I took one of the larger tusks to bring to a weapon-smith to be made into a dagger. My total amount of money comes to 51 credits, and once again I upgrade my storage space to a total of 7 cubed meters and leaving me with 27 credits which quickly becomes 26 after purchasing myself dinner on the way back home.
I walk home with a tired gait despite having cut my hunting trip short, as the constant movement in the forest and the long trek to and back from the gate have worn me down. I decide that I should bring up moving closer within the city when I make more money so that I don't have to waste so much time walking to the center of the city, not to mention that Mira would be closer to work as well.
I get to the apartment and walk up to our floor where I immediately take a shower to wash all the dirt, blood, and grime off of my body and change into a clean pair of clothes I retrieve from my storage. With the remaining time I have left today, I summon Jareth to once again take a look at his injury and see that it has healed already with barely a scar to prove that there was even damage to that area before.
With Jareth healthy I plop down on the couch and have him sit beside me while we watch television in the living room, television is one of the few things still existing from the previous age as even God recognized not much good would come from humans being bored. Jareth seems to really enjoy the television, especially anything with fighting or action, it seems like he's quite the war-monger.
We spend the rest of the day just relaxing until it gets to around dinner and I hand Jareth a core while I take out the dinner that I had bought from storage and we begin to dig in. It becomes late and I resign myself to go to bed knowing that Mira has once again become engrossed in her work and will probably end up sleeping there. So with a sigh I return Jareth to his crystal and fall into bed, preparing to rest for the incoming day, knowing I'm going to be quite busy.
